Info About What The Maintenance Engineer Role Entails

Exciting electro‑mechanical Maintenance Engineer role on a small night shift team, supervising one Technician in a fast‑paced, high‑tech manufacturing facility. You will maintain a cutting‑edge 24 hour production line including pick & placement machines, SMT screen printers, ovens, conveyors, automated optical inspection machines, assembly lines, robotics, conveyors & laser marking machines amongst others.

The night shift can be a challenge as there are fewer people available to help, so you will be comfortable with root cause analysis & fault diagnosis/identification. Alongside reactive maintenance & planned maintenance activities, you will run small CI projects to improve downtime and machinery performance.

Essential Requirements Of The Maintenance Engineer
  • Time served or HNC (or equivalent) qualification in an electrical, mechanical or electro‑mechanical engineering discipline. You will perform many small mechanical adjustments; 3‑phase electrical maintenance is minimal.
  • 2/3 + years of experience in a similar role – some experience in a maintenance environment is essential.
  • Some knowledge of electrical & electronic systems & sensors, e.g. PLCs, vision systems, fibre optic sensors, mechanics, pneumatics, robotics and test equipment.
  • Good problem‑solving & decision‑making skills; you will be able to fault find, diagnose, and have a strong track record of fault finding and RCA.
  • Experience with RCA‑driven improvements to machines & processes – e.g. RCA methodologies, SMED, 5 Whys, fishbone, Ishikawa; predictive and preventative strategy.
  • Proactive mindset, always looking for cost savings and improvements.
Desirable Requirements Of The Maintenance Engineer
  • Experience with robotics, conveyors or hydraulics.
  • 18th Edition qualified.
  • Experience mentoring or leading apprentices – if you don't have that experience, it can be developed with in‑house management courses, 1:2s & distance learning opportunities.
  • Lean – proactive approach to eliminate waste, SMED, etc., across people, process and equipment.
